Commercial pressure washing services involve the use of high-pressure water streams to clean the exterior surfaces of buildings, sidewalks, parking lots, and other large-scale structures. This process effectively removes dirt, grime, mold, algae, grease, and other stubborn stains that accumulate over time. Professionals ut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ure thorough cleaning without damaging surfaces, helping maintain the appearance and integrity of commercial properties. The service can be tailored to specific surfaces and cleaning needs, making it a versatile option for various types of properties.
This service addresses common problems such as the buildup of dirt and contaminants that can lead to surface deterioration, safety hazards, and a negative impression for visitors or customers. For example, grease and oil stains on parking lots can create slip hazards, while mold and algae on building exteriors can cause surfaces to become slippery and unsightly. Regular pressure washing can prevent long-term damage caused by environmental factors and help uphold the property's value by keeping it looking clean and well-maintained.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Pressure Washing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mount Laurel,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Surface Cleaning Costs - Commercial pressure washing for surface areas such as parking lots or building exteriors typically ranges from $0.10 to $0.50 per square foot. For example, cleaning a 10,000-square-foot surface might cost between $1,000 and $5,000 depending on complexity and location.
Building Exterior Washing - The cost to pressure wash building exteriors generally falls between $0.50 and $1.50 per square foot. A standard commercial building of 20,000 square feet could expect to pay approximately $10,000 to $30,000 for a thorough cleaning.
Driveway & Sidewalk Cleaning - Commercial pressure washing for driveways and sidewalks usually costs between $150 and $600 for smaller areas, with larger or more heavily soiled spaces potentially reaching $1,000 or more.
Equipment & Surface Type - Costs can vary based on the type of surface and equipment used, with concrete and brick surfaces often costing more to clean. Typical prices might range from $0.20 to $1.00 per square foot, depending on the material and condition.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
